-
Marseille is a well-known city of
about 800000permanent residents. It has all the facilities you may
need, such as banks, travel agencies, garages, catholic and protestant
churches, taxis, hospital, general practitioners and specialists,
dentists, chemists, kindergarten, restaurants, snack-bars, pizzerias,
cinemas, night-clubs, etc…
-
A southern climate and high
winds make Marseille the sunniest town in France. In May, the
temperature is usually around 20°C, with the sea around 17-19°C. The
Scuba diving season is just kicking off at this time, but swimming is
only for the brave. May is certainly the best month for walking in the
Calanques, as in summer they are closed due to the risk of fire.
